Great River Children's Museum

Who We Are

Great River Children's Museum (GRCM) is a nonprofit children's museum in St. Cloud, Minnesota, dedicated to inspiring learning through the power of play. We believe every child deserves opportunities to explore, create, imagine, and discover in environments that nurture curiosity and strengthen family connections. Serving children from birth through age 10 and the caring adults in their lives, GRCM offers interactive exhibits, educational programs, community events, and outreach experiences designed to spark curiosity and support healthy development. Our experiences encourage children to build problem-solving skills, creativity, confidence, collaboration, and a lifelong love of learning. As a community gathering place, GRCM partners with schools, nonprofits, healthcare providers, libraries, businesses, artists, and cultural organizations to increase access to high-quality play and learning opportunities for all families. Through affordable admission, scholarship programs, community partnerships, and outreach initiatives, we strive to ensure every child can experience the benefits of play, regardless of financial circumstances or ability.
